I was born and raised in southern Kansas, attended schools there and then attended Kansas State College at Pittsburg before transferring to the University of Missouri where I completed a BA degree in Political Science and History. The Vietnam War was raging and Uncle Sam soon summoned me to become an Air Force officer. After a year of training I received my dream assignment to Japan where I served for three years as a Communication Officer. Leaving the Air Force I pursued a degree in Public Administration at the University of Kansas. This led to a career as a local administrator in New Mexico and California before deciding to open my own business. After successfully operating my business for a number of years health forced me to start another career as an educator that, ultimately, brought me to Texas. In addition to my full-time employment I had remained in the Air Force Reserve and retired at the rank of L.t Colonel.

Since retirement I have devoted my time to politics and religion. Presently, I am moderator for on line classes for the ENDTIME Ministries and have served as a Precinct Chair in Denton County.
